Changelog

1.4.0
	Bug fixes:
	* sig chase return code fix (patch from Rafael Justo, bug id 189)
	* rdata.c memory leaks on error and allocation checks fixed (patch
	  from Shane Kerr, bug id 188)
	* zone.c memory leaks on error and allocation checks fixed (patch
	from Shane Kerr, bug id 189)
	* ldns-zsplit output and error messages fixed (patch from Shane Kerr,
	  bug id 190)
	* Fixed potential buffer overflow in ldns_str2rdf_dname
	* Signing code no longer signs delegation NS rrsets
	* Some minor configure/makefile updates
	* Fixed a bug in the randomness initialization
	* Fixed a bug in the reading of resolv.conf
	* Fixed a bug concerning whitespace in zone data (with patch from Ondrej
	  Sury, bug 213)
	* Fixed a small fallback problem in axfr client code
	
	API CHANGES:
	* added 2str convenience functions:
		- ldns_rr_type2str
		- ldns_rr_class2str
		- ldns_rr_type2buffer_str
		- ldns_rr_class2buffer_str
	* buffer2str() is now called ldns_buffer2str
	* base32 and base64 function names are now also prepended with ldns_
          (old functions retained for now for backwards compatibility)
	* ldns_rr_new_frm_str() now returns an error on missing RDATA fields.
	  Since you cannot read QUESTION section RRs with this anymore,
	  there is now a function called ldns_rr_new_question_frm_str()

	LIBRARY FEATURES:
	* DS RRs string representation now add bubblebabble in a comment
	  (patch from Jakob Schlyter)
	* DLV RR type added
	* TCP fallback system has been improved
	* HMAC-SHA256 TSIG support has been added.
	* TTLS are now correcly set in NSEC(3) records when signing zones
	
	EXAMPLE TOOLS:
	* New example: ldns-revoke to revoke DNSKEYs according to RFC5011
	* ldns-testpkts has been fixed and updated
	* ldns-signzone now has the option to not add the DNSKEY
	* ldns-signzone now has an (full zone only) opt-out option for
	                NSEC3
	* ldns-keygen can create HMAC-SHA1 and HMAC-SHA256 symmetric keys
	* ldns-walk output has been fixed
	* ldns-compare-zones has been fixed, and now has an option
	  to show all differences (-a)
	* ldns-read-zone now has an option to print DNSSEC records only
